工控python和unity学哪个
-
个人建议是根据自己的兴趣、职业发展以及学习需求来选择学习工控python还是unity。下面是对两者的介绍和比较,供参考:
一、工控python介绍
工控python是指使用python语言开发和运行的工业控制系统。它可以用于编写和执行自动化任务、数据采集、设备控制和工程监控等工控应用。工控python具有易学易用的特点,语法简洁清晰,生态丰富,可灵活应对各种工控需求。学习工控python可以让你掌握在工控领域开发和维护系统所需要的技能,对于从事或有意向从事工控行业的人来说是非常有价值的。二、Unity介绍
Unity是一种跨平台的游戏开发引擎,它提供了丰富的工具和资源用于创建高质量的游戏和交互式应用。通过学习Unity,你可以掌握三维建模、动画、物理模拟等游戏开发所需的技能。Unity的应用不仅仅局限于游戏开发,它也可以用于虚拟现实、增强现实和模拟训练等领域。如果你对游戏开发和虚拟现实等方面有浓厚的兴趣,学习Unity是个不错的选择。三、选择的依据
1. 兴趣:首先要考虑自己的兴趣和对于工控和游戏开发的偏好。如果你对于工控系统的开发和维护比较感兴趣,那么学习工控python是一个不错的选择。如果你对于游戏开发、虚拟现实和增强现实等方面更感兴趣,那么学习Unity可能更适合你。2. 职业发展:考虑自己未来的职业发展方向。工控系统和工业自动化领域发展迅速,对于工控python开发人员的需求也在增加。如果你计划从事工控行业,学习工控python是一个比较有前景的选择。而Unity在游戏开发和虚拟现实等领域也有广泛的应用,如果你想从事这些领域的工作,学习Unity会有更多的机会和发展空间。
3. 学习需求:考虑自己的学习需求。工控python和Unity都是有学习曲线的,需要一定的时间和精力去学习和实践。根据自己的学习需求和时间安排,选择适合的学习内容和学习方法。如果你喜欢动手实践,更注重实际项目的经验积累,那么工控python可能更适合你。如果你对于创作和艺术表现更感兴趣,喜欢进行创意和设计,那么Unity可能更适合你。
综上所述,选择学习工控python还是Unity,要结合自己的兴趣、职业发展和学习需求来进行判断。无论选择哪个,都需要持续学习和实践,不断提高自己的技能和知识水平。最终目标是根据自己的兴趣和职业规划,选择适合自己的学习内容和发展方向。
2年前 -
要回答这个问题,首先需要了解工控Python和Unity两个领域的基本概念和应用场景。然后,我们可以从以下五个方面对比和分析工控Python和Unity,以帮助你决定学哪个。
1. 领域:工控Python是一种专门用于工业自动化控制的编程语言,主要用于程序控制、数据采集和通信等方面;而Unity是一款游戏引擎,主要用于设计和开发游戏、虚拟现实和增强现实等应用。
2. 学习曲线:工控Python相对于其他编程语言而言,门槛较低,易于上手。相比之下,Unity对于没有任何游戏开发经验的初学者来说,需要花费较长的时间去学习和理解其基本概念和操作。
3. 应用领域:工控Python主要在工业自动化控制领域得到广泛应用,例如控制机器人、自动化生产线以及工艺过程等;而Unity主要用于游戏开发和虚拟现实应用,如设计游戏场景、创建游戏角色和物体,并实现各种交互功能。
4. 就业前景:根据行业需求的不同,工控Python和Unity的就业前景也会有所不同。目前,工控Python在工业自动化领域的需求较大,而Unity在游戏和虚拟现实行业也有很多就业机会。
5. 个人兴趣和发展方向:最重要的是要考虑个人的兴趣和发展方向。如果你对工业自动化、机器人技术以及数据采集和控制等方面感兴趣,那么学习工控Python可能更适合你。如果你对游戏设计和虚拟现实技术感兴趣,并希望在游戏开发行业或者虚拟现实领域发展,那么学习Unity可能更加合适。
综上所述,选择学习工控Python还是Unity,主要取决于你的兴趣、学习曲线、应用领域和个人发展方向。希望以上分析能够帮助你做出明智的选择。
2年前 -
如果要选择工控Python和Unity中的一个进行学习,首先需要明确两者的特点和应用场景。
工控Python是一种基于Python语言的编程工具,主要用于工业控制系统的编程和自动化。它具有简单易学、灵活性强、开源免费等特点,特别适合于小型工控系统的开发和运行。工控Python可以通过编写脚本实现各种功能,比如数据采集、设备控制、数据处理等。在工业领域中,工控Python可以应用于自动化生产线、智能设备的控制和监控系统等。
Unity是一款专业的游戏开发引擎,它提供了强大的图形渲染和物理模拟功能,可以用于创建2D和3D的游戏或交互应用程序。Unity提供了易于使用的可视化编辑器和强大的脚本编程接口,开发者可以通过编写C#脚本来实现游戏逻辑、交互设计、图形效果等。Unity不仅仅用于游戏开发,还可以应用于虚拟现实(VR)、增强现实(AR)、仿真训练等领域。
根据个人的兴趣和职业发展方向,可以选择学习其中一个工具。
如果选择学习工控Python,可以按照以下步骤进行学习:
1. 学习Python基础知识:了解Python的语法、数据类型、函数、流程控制等基本概念;
2. 学习工控相关知识:了解工控系统的基本原理和组成、常用的通讯协议、硬件设备等;
3. 学习工控Python的库和工具:掌握Python在工控领域中常用的第三方库,如PySerial、PyModbus等;
4. 实践项目:尝试编写一些简单的工控系统的控制程序,如数据采集、设备控制等;
5. 深入学习:进一步学习高级的工控Python编程技术,如多线程编程、数据库操作等。如果选择学习Unity,可以按照以下步骤进行学习:
1. 学习Unity基础知识:了解Unity的界面、场景编辑、资源管理等基本操作;
2. 学习C#编程语言:掌握C#的基本语法、面向对象编程等概念;
3. 学习Unity的脚本编程:了解Unity的脚本编程接口,如组件、事件、协程等;
4. 实践项目:尝试创建一些简单的游戏或交互应用程序,如平台跳跃游戏、射击游戏等;
5. 深入学习:进一步学习高级的Unity开发技术,如物理模拟、人工智能、多人联机等。无论选择学习工控Python还是Unity,都需要通过实践项目来巩固和应用所学知识。可以选择一些小型的项目来逐步提升自己的编程技能。此外,广泛阅读相关的教程、文档和技术资料也是学习过程中重要的补充。
2年前